The first big step to being fit and famous

Twelve young men and women from all over the country have been selected to compete for the title Fit ‘n Right Ambassadors in a new reality show called Got 2B Fit Challenge.

From among thousands of hopefuls who underwent auditions and evaluation, the ten finalists will be sent to the Fit ‘n Right camp at the Las Haciendas in Batangas where they will have to undergo both physical and mental challenges to help them achieve the body type they’ve always aspired for.

From FAT to FIT

Ten years ago, JM Rodriguez was a jiggly 200-pound young man who did not care if his belly was sticking out of his trousers. He admits that fastfood outlets and restaurants were his favorite hangout places. “I was a common fixture at McDonald’s, KFC, TGIF, even Goodah. I was so huge, I couldn’t care less.”
